The art of picking up a good Kanchiwaram silk saree

This is a major headache for most buyers.
In our good old days we used to trust the shopkeepers and shop only in those we trust.
A good silk saree should have weight atleast 400-500 grams it should weigh with out the zari. With zari it should be around 450-600 or even more depending on the zari work.
Always buy a heavy sari and do not buy thin saris as these are cheap ones and they shall never withstand the test of time.
The rate of a sari is determined largely by the weight, then its zari work, border colours and pallu works. For contrast borders and pallu the price will be more. The width of the border also increases with increase in price.
The colour of some saris also increase their price. A double shaded saree will cost you more than a sari of the same weight in a single colour. A saree with zari bootis also will cost you more.
In short, a sari with more work and design will be costlier than a saree with little or no design or work.
Nowadays with silk mark available you can trust the saree that possess this mark and buy the same with out any doubt in your mind.
